What we can offer you

Guaranteed Training Contract interview

We guarantee all Vacation Scheme participants the opportunity to interview for a Training Contract with two of our partners at the end of your scheme.

Supportive environment

You will be allocated work and be supervised by one of our lawyers who will provide you with stimulating on the job tasks. We will also match you with a mentor who can support you and offer guidance.

Learning and Development

Through our induction sessions, practical workshops, team building events and networking opportunities you will be able to develop and hone the key skills needed to be a successful trainee.

Benefits

You will be paid £650 per week.

SMART Commitment

Ashurst Perkins Coie is a partner of Aspiring Solicitors' Social Mobility and Real Talent (SMART) Commitment initiative. The program provides confidential funding for eligible candidates from lower socio-economic backgrounds to cover business attire and accommodation costs during Ashurst Perkins Coie's Vacation Scheme. Participation is confidential and anonymous. Details on applying for support are given to successful Vacation Scheme candidates.

The recruitment process

Applications are open to finalists and graduates of all degree disciplines. To qualify, you should be on track to achieve a 2.1 in your undergraduate degree.

If you haven't met this criteria and there are mitigating circumstances, you will have an opportunity to provide us with this information on your application.

Our online application form allows you to showcase your talent, your passion for the industry and your knowledge of our firm. You will have the opportunity to share your insights into the legal industry and more details about yourself.

Note:
You cannot apply for both a vacation scheme and a training contract in the same recruitment window. Please only apply for one opportunity during the recruitment window. If you complete a vacation scheme with us, you will be interviewed for a training contract at the end of the scheme.

After the application closing date, we will ask you to complete an online assessment. The assessment measures a range of critical reasoning and behavioral strengths that align to a trainee role at Ashurst Perkins Coie. The assessment has been designed to give you a realistic preview into life at the firm and the types of scenarios you might experience as a trainee.

While we recommend completing the online assessment in one sitting, it is untimed so you can complete it at your own pace. It will take around 60 minutes to complete, and you will have 7 days to complete the test once from the time you receive the link. Once completed, you will be sent an individual feedback report outlining your key strengths and development areas.

You can learn about the types of questions you may be asked in the assessment here. Please note that if you do not complete the test within the specified time, we will be unable to progress your application.

If you meet the requirements of the online tests and application, you may be invited to book a place at an online assessment center. You will complete a written case study facilitated by a member of the Early Careers team. This exercise is designed to evaluate your analytical and problem-solving skills.

If you reach the benchmark at the assessment center, you will be invited to the final stage, which involves attending an in-person assessment day at our office. During this stage, you will meet current trainees for a Q&A session and take part in a guided tour of the office to learn more about Ashurst Perkins Coie . The process includes a group exercise to assess your teamwork, collaboration, and further analytical and problem-solving skills, as well as an interview with an Associate and a member of the Early Careers team.

We are committed to making all stages of our recruitment process accessible to candidates with disabilities or long-term health conditions. If you consider yourself to have a disability or a long-term health condition, please feel able to be open about this at any point during the recruitment process. If you are not sure what adjustments you require, we will work with you to establish the most suitable adjustments at each stage of the recruitment process. Please note that our online application form includes a section which allows you to advise us of any extenuating circumstances that are relevant for us to consider when reviewing your application form.

Please get in touch if you would like to talk to us about any queries you may have on your disability or long-term health condition and the recruitment process. Any information disclosed on your disability will remain strictly confidential.
